Hamlet (2,2) What Players Are They
Apr. 8th, 2012 12:12 pmWhatever Hamletian ambiguity may exist in response to the arrival of the players, it is clear that there is in it a genuine joy for Hamlet as an obvious theater enthusiast, and this perhaps breeds a little creativity into his pressed and strained mind, a freeing up.
